Google Vault is an ediscovery and archiving service for messaging and content created through some applications in G Suite. Users can retain, search, and export an organization’s data from select apps with Vault for G Suite Business and Enterprise editions.N/A

Formerly from Micro Focus, a solution used to archive email, social collaboration, and mobile data from multiple platforms in a single location. OpenText™ Retain Unified Archiving supports Exchange, Microsoft 365, Gmail, Bloomberg, and OpenText™ GroupWise for both on-premises and cloud deployments.N/A
